Aberdeen Hires GCW For Hemel Hempstead Centre

May 20, 2013

Aberdeen Asset Management has hired retail specialist GCW as joint letting agent at its Riverside Shopping Centre in Hemel Hempstead.

GCW has been appointed joint letting agent, alongside Angermann Goddard & Loyd, to bolster the tenant mix in the 320,000 sq ft scheme. Riverside Shopping Centre is anchored by Debenhams and other tenants include H&M, Next, TK Maxx, Waterstones, Starbucks and Monsoon. Leisure operators include Pizza Express, Premier Inn and Anytime Fitness.

There are currently six units vacant in the centre, measuring between 1,600 sq ft and 9,900 sq ft. These include a prominent 3,000 sq ft ground-floor leisure unit. Aberdeen would also consider merging three of the units to create a 10,500 sq ft flagship retail store.

The Riverside Shopping Centre is located in the centre of Hemel Hempstead, which is one of Hertfordshire’s largest towns and enjoys excellent transport links into London.
